X-Git-Url: https://git.octo.it/?a=blobdiff_plain;f=bindings%2Fperl%2FOping.xs;h=5731d3d8088f28d4df8eb826dba4ab232b1b1b98;hb=40b25e68fc4d7d77bb8968bb1961f69689b8a30e;hp=6106e13760cae899222033299c08e0f88ab35b8d;hpb=5a2d8718ca250276308a7e9a9395870de119b753;p=liboping.git diff --git a/bindings/perl/Oping.xs b/bindings/perl/Oping.xs index 6106e13..5731d3d 100644 --- a/bindings/perl/Oping.xs +++ b/bindings/perl/Oping.xs @@ -183,8 +183,9 @@ _ping_iterator_get_hostname (iter) free (buffer); break; } + buffer[buffer_size - 1] = 0; - XPUSHs (sv_2mortal (newSVpvn(buffer,buffer_size))); + XPUSHs (sv_2mortal (newSVpvn(buffer, strlen (buffer)))); free(buffer); } while (0);